Transaction 255f750076ce58e828f505e808f04f8b98633edeeb22bd6598084496e6a892ac

1 Input
2 Outputs
  • 255f750076ce58e828f505e808f04f8b98633edeeb22bd6598084496e6a892ac:0
  • value  76459384
    address  3P8qkUSxd3WzvKXCDY5z1atZN8bqJuVBZS
  • 255f750076ce58e828f505e808f04f8b98633edeeb22bd6598084496e6a892ac:1
  • value  18445592
    address  1Ab7jE7kRYsPYqFoFiHucLqLLwvKU4ka4J